Description

Tenant in place until July 2026 Oversized one-bedroom, one and a half bathroom apartment, in the iconic white glove condominium on Fifth Avenue in midtown Manhattan This famed condominium offers full-time doorman and concierge service, attended elevators, with valet, laundry and housekeeping services available to residents. Fabulous brand new amenity floor offering a fitness center including Peloton bikes, a circuit training space and a stretching corner, a private yoga studio, a coffee/wet bar, a residential lounge, private event space, chef's table, stadium seating movie theater, library, business center, conference rooms, children's playroom, billiards room and more. Situated right in the heart of Billionaires Row, Trump Tower is surrounded by the most prestigious, high-end shops, hotels, restaurants, and entertainment venues, such as The Plaza Hotel, Bergdorf Goodman, Tiffany’s, Gucci, Armani, and Louis Vuitton. Midtown East is a dynamic hub that is the gateway to Manhattan for many. Home to iconic landmarks like Grand Central Terminal and the Chrysler Building, the neighborhood offers unparalleled convenience for commuters and professionals. The residential landscape is a mix of high-rise luxury towers and historic side-street cooperatives, providing a wide array of options for those who want to be at the center of the city's energy.

Mansion tax applies at this price point

New York State charges the buyer a mansion tax on residential purchases at $1,000,000 or more. At this asking price the tier is $1M to $1,999,999 at 1.00%, applied to the whole purchase price. It is due in cash at closing and cannot be financed.
